I keep having trouble with irritated throat while tuning.  Does anyone =
else?  After a day of several tunings my throat feels as if I have gone =
through a very long ardurous choral rehearsal.  I have to have lozenges =
(sp) in my pocket at all times or I suffer major coughing fits.

Years ago, while studying at Eastman School of Music I had to do a =
presentation on tunings, and I played a recording of ascending tones.  A =
very odd reaction occurred in which many of the people in the class =
experienced a throat constriction as the pitch being heard reached the =
top of their vocal range.  This was obvious as people swallowed, or =
clutched at their throats as the sensation hit them.  We all laughed at =
it at the time.  Now I wonder if, in tuning, I am unconsciously matching =
the pitches I am sounding with a tightening of my vocal chords.
  Does this problem resonate with anyone else? =20
